A green snake slithered across coach windows while it was parked up waiting for passengers to return from lunch.

The small serpent emerged inside the vehicle while it was stopped alongside a forest in Saraburi province on May 30.

The creature later returned on its own into the wilderness.

Driver Sai said: 'I was relieved there were no passengers at the time. It would have scared the life out of them.

'I see all kinds of strange animals on the road so I could stay calm and wait for the snake to leave.'

The reptile seen in the video is a golden tree snake. They are a mildly venomous, rear-fanged colubrid snake native to Southeast Asia.

They are known for their incredible ability to glide from tree to tree, flattening their bodies and ribs to create a parachute effect.
